Mobile-first HR for hourly micro-workshops — attendance, leave and payroll automation targets a $9.0B = 15M micro and small employers in emerging markets × $600 ACV average for basic HR/attendance/payroll per year total addressable market with medium saturation and a year-over-year growth rate of ≈12% YoY (MarketsandMarkets / Gartner estimates for HR software & SMB digitalization in emerging markets, 2023–2025).
Key trends driving demand: Smartphone-first SMB adoption — cheaper smartphones and data make mobile-native HR experiences viable for micro-businesses.; Localization and vernacular AI — improved speech-to-text and OCR in local languages reduces onboarding friction for low-literacy workers.; Digital payroll rails — UPI and mobile wallet integrations simplify wage disbursement and reduce the need for cash payroll.; Regulatory pressure for digital records — local labor regulations increasingly favor digital attendance/payroll evidence which drives demand.; Shift to subscription micro-SaaS — small owners prefer low monthly subscriptions with simple setup over enterprise contracts..
Key competitors include greytHR, Keka HR, Zoho People.
